Expression of Interest for Consulting Services for Feasibility Study, Detailed Engineering Design (DED), and Construction Supervision for Selected TIs The consulting services (the Services) is to provide all professional and technical services, including evaluating technical feasibility and economic viability of the selected project activities; detailing project definition with consideration for technical, economic, environmental, social and other relevant factors; and recommending whether to proceed with the project and under what conditions. These are related to (i) conduct the feasibility study, (ii) complete detailed engineering design plan for the multi-storey building (Architectural Drawing, Structural Drawing, MEP (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ing) Drawing, Substructure Drawing, and Superstructure Drawing); (iii) prepare the detailed and completed Bill of Quantities (BoQ) and their procurement documents; (iv) construction scheduling and management plan; (v) Environmental and Social Assessment, following by site specific Environmental and Social management Plan (ESMP), as per the requirements of the World banks ESF and national regulations; (vi) workers codes of conduct (CoC), Labor Management Procedures (LMP), and SEP.; (vii) occupational safety and health (OSH) and OSH plan in the workplace in Building; (viii) carry out construction supervision; (ix) carry out Environmental and Social safeguards monitoring and reporting and reviewing tender documents for the TIs by making sure that ESF requirements (and OSH plan) are embedded in the bidding documents; (x) to assess risk and develop plan for demolishing existing facilities where the new building will be constructed taking into account environmental pollution and mitigation measures; material storage and transport, disposal; and OSH requirements (including removal of hazardous materials such as asbestos and/or harmful chemical/biological products if any); and (xi) project management with Construction Supervision /compliance with contractual terms and conditions. The design concept of the newly constructed multi-storey building should be safe, reliable, cost effective, energy saving (aiming zero energy loss), well-ventilated with adequate light, environment friendly, seismic resistant, accessible to people with disabilities, well-equipped with CCTV& fire fighting, public address and fire alarm, parking, plumbing, drainage, boundary wall and communication facilities. The selected Consulting firm shall, on behalf of PMU (MLVT), manage the construction permit requirements (and building height) with the relevant government agencies as set forth by the Ministry of Land management, Urban Planning and Construction (General Department of Construction).
